Job Description

Category Nursing - RN-MS Job Type Travel Advance your career in a dynamic hospital setting specializing in orthopedic, medical-surgical, and telemetry patient care. In this contract opportunity, you'll apply your clinical expertise to deliver high-quality, compassionate nursing care within a collaborative team environment. Your adaptability and dedication will ensure continuity of care as you support various units throughout the facility.
Schedule/Hours:
Night shift: 7:00 PM - 7:30
AM Qualifications:
Active and current RN license Minimum of 1-2 years of recent experience in med-surg, telemetry, or orthopedic nursing BLS certification required; ACLS preferred Strong clinical assessment, organization, and communication skills Flexibility to float to other units as needed Ability to adapt to changing patient and unit needs
Responsibilities:
Deliver safe, effective nursing care to diverse adult patient populations, including those in medical-surgical, orthopedic, and telemetry settings Assess, plan, implement, and evaluate patient care while collaborating with interdisciplinary healthcare teams Accurately document assessments, interventions, and patient progress in accordance with hospital standards Respond promptly to changes in patient status and provide critical interventions as necessary Support patient education and advocate for patient needs throughout the hospital stay Flex as operational needs require, which may include floating to other units or covering open shifts within the system
